COMPLEX OF THE ENDOGLUCANASE CEL5A FROM BACILLUS AGARADHEARANS AT 1.08 ANGSTROM RESOLUTION WITH CELLOBIO-DERIVED ISOFAGOMINE

About this Structure

1OCQ is a [Single protein] structure of sequence from [Bacillus agaradhaerens] with BGC, SO4, IFM and GOL as [ligands]. Active as [Cellulase], with EC number [3.2.1.4]. Structure known Active Site: NUC. Full crystallographic information is available from [OCA].

Reference

Direct observation of the protonation state of an imino sugar glycosidase inhibitor upon binding., Varrot A, Tarling CA, Macdonald JM, Stick RV, Zechel DL, Withers SG, Davies GJ, J Am Chem Soc. 2003 Jun 25;125(25):7496-7. PMID:12812472
